When vehicles are abandoned, destroyed, or seized by police, they should route to an impound lot. A complete script allows you to set custom unimpound fees and restrict access based on player jobs. Job and Gang Garages
A garage script in QBCore handles the storage, retrieval, and management of vehicles. Unlike standard GTA V, where cars simply disappear when you walk away, a roleplay server requires persistence. A "full" garage script typically includes:
A poorly coded garage script constantly checks player coordinates, causing "Resmon spikes" (high CPU lag).
Dedicated garages for specific jobs (e.g., EMS, Police) or gang-specific storage.
